Research Projects

There are several research focus groups within the laboratory. The areas of research include the pharmacogenomics of epilepsy, pharmacogenomics of several psychological disorders including drug addiction, pharmacogenomis of metabolic disorders, obesity, pre-term labour and asthma; and genetics of immuno-pharmacology. Funding
The main source of funding has been the High Impact Re

search Grant from the Ministry of Higher Education, also from the University Malaya Research Grant (UMRG). Most of the postgraduate students have also obtained the University Malaya postgraduate research grants (PPP). The research team are also looking into research collaborations that will bring in external funding. Equipment
The Pharmacogenomic Laboratory is equipped for molecular and tissue culture research. All basic equipment like thermal cyclers, centrifuges, autoclave, incubators, gel documentation system are available.
